Role Overview :

This is an on-property role where you will be based in our hotel office space located at Apex City Quay Dundee, Apex Waterloo, Apex Grassmarket and head office on a rotation basis. Within our Events and Groups team we work to a rota, with core hours covering the office hours between 8:30am – 6pm.

As GCE Executive you will be responsible for effectively promoting all event & group services and functions across our group of hotels to achieve maximum sales revenue and client satisfaction for each booking. You will be the key point of contact for all group accommodation and event enquiries and working as a team, you will be integral in ensuring the achievement of all departmental revenue targets, budgets and KPIs.

Managing the process from initial enquiry through to post-event follow‑up, ensuring a seamless and memorable experience for guests.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Manage incoming Group room, Conference and Event enquiries in accordance with all departmental SOPs from initial contact to final billing, including enquiries from direct bookers across all market segments, MICE agents and third‑party partner platforms.
  • Enter all details into company systems (PMS/Sales & Catering/Restaurant systems), reporting on all activity conducted with each enquiry and booking.
  • Proactively promote group wide hotel facilities to maximise revenue from group accommodation and events. Striving to exceed all department KPI’s and targets.
  • Meet all company standards of procedure for enquiries and existing bookings with key focus on conversion and maximising profitability.
  • Responsible for ensuring all assigned client group accommodation and/or event details are communicated expertly, with the highest degree of accuracy and attention to detail via Operational Function sheets.
  • Accountable for preparing and issuing all associated admin to the highest standard in terms of accuracy and aligned to event life‑cycle deadlines, such as but not limited to proposals, contracts, invoices, deposit payments, in line with company standards.
  • Maintain accurate records of all bookings using the hotel’s CRM or booking system.
  • Proactively liaise with clients to understand their needs and tailor event packages; accordingly, through in‑person appointments and virtual meetings, including carrying out on‑property client appointments and show rounds.
  • Coordinate and build relationships with internal stakeholders and colleagues to ensure smooth event execution.
  • Follow up with clients post‑event to gather feedback and secure repeat or multiyear business and/or carry out proactive sales calls as instructed.
